I needed something that held a 1M aluminum corner channel for a lamp. I used a NodeMCU ESP32 as the controller

I used some black aluminum 90-degree corner LED channel. All the channel I have purchased have been the same size, 16 mm on both sides, hopefully any 16 mm channel will fit.

I used a 144LED/M IP30 WS2812B strip and a 5V 3A power supply, but if you want it brighter you'll need an 8A supply. WLED controls the current to the LEDS, so I just set it to 2000mA and the 3A can handle it. Hopefully, the LEDS should last longer at lower power.

I used brass inserts and M3 screws to attach the base.
M3 5MM OD brass insert

M3 X 10mm Screw with flat head

Print flat side down, I only used support for the internal lamp holder hole lip.
